Description

A vulnerability in the Layer 2 Tunneling Protocol (L2TP) feature of Cisco IOS XE Software could allow an unauthenticated, remote attacker to cause a denial of service (DoS) condition on an affected device.

This vulnerability is due to improper handling of certain L2TP packets. An attacker could exploit this vulnerability by sending crafted L2TP packets to an affected device. A successful exploit could allow the attacker to cause the device to reload unexpectedly, resulting in a DoS condition.

Note: Only traffic directed to the affected system can be used to exploit this vulnerability.

How this vulnerability can be exploited

This issue can be reached over the network, attack complexity is low, an attacker needs no privileges on the target. No user interaction is required. The scope is changed, meaning a successful attack can affect components beyond the vulnerable one. Rated impact: confidentiality none, integrity none, availability high.
